Ferrari, Red Bull and McLaren at wet tyre test

– Ferrari, Red Bull and McLaren will take part in Pirelli's dedicated wet tyre test session at the Paul Ricard circuit later this month, the manufacturer has revealed.Pirelli's two-day test, which is set to take place from January 25-26, will be focused on wet-tyre running, with different prototypes to be trialled by the three teams.All 11 teams will be in action at the subsequent pre-season group tests at the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ya, scheduled for February 22-25 and March 1-4 respectively.Formula 1's governing body, the FIA, has also made provisions for six, two-day tyre tests during the 2016 season, specifically to assist Pirelli with its development.
